DAZN picks up rights to Canelo Álvarez bout following promoter split
Over-the-top sports subscription service DAZN has acquired rights to broadcast Saul ‘Canelo’ Álvarez’s world super middleweight fight against England’s Callum Smith on December 19.

Sky nets 2.6m audience peak for Scotland’s Euro 2020 play-off win as paywall removed
Scotland’s win over Serbia in last week’s Euro 2020 play-off attracted a peak audience of 2.6 million viewers in the UK after pay-television operator Sky made the match available on a free-to-air basis.
Rugby Europe hires River Media Partners, Sports Media Venture to sell rights
Rugby Europe, the administrative body for rugby union in Europe, has hired the River Media Partners and Sports Media Venture agencies to develop its media and sponsorship rights revenues

IBU predicts €2.8m loss after organiser payments, Covid tests, lower TV revenues
The International Biathlon Union has revised its budget for the 2020-21 period to cater for the effects of the Covid-19 pandemic and is now forecasting a loss of €2.84m ($3.36m).
Uefa club competitions TV rights on the market in Greece
The Team Marketing agency has today (Monday) initiated sales processes in Greece for broadcast rights to the Uefa Champions League, Europa League and Europa Conference League from 2021-22 to 2023-24
IMG Arena keeps hold of World Snooker Tour betting rights
IMG Arena, the sports betting arm of the IMG agency, has retained the betting streaming rights to one of its leading properties by signing a long-term renewal to its agreement with World Snooker Tour
British Basketball League nets domestic TV deal as Sky back on board
The British Basketball League has been buoyed by the return of a rights deal with a domestic broadcaster in a two-year agreement with pay-television broadcaster Sky
